Study Description

Brief Summary

Program Ready2E.A.T. was developed to be tested in the upper limb reeducation on population at risk, such as:

  • Children with dysfunction

  • Cognitive impaired elderly

  • Dementia people

Condition or Disease Intervention/Treatment Phase
  • Other: Ready2E.A.T. PROGRAM

Detailed Description

Program Ready2E.A.T. consists on the training of specific upper limb tasks, including:
  • reaching during attention tasks

  • reaching during memory tasks

  • reaching during sequential motor tasks

  • reaching during fine hand movements

This program has been tested as a measure of functional status (cognitive and motor habilities) in population with different risks; It also has been tested as an effective program for reeducation in cognitive affected population.

Arms and Interventions

Arm Intervention/Treatment
Conventional therapy

Group doing conventional rehabilitation was assessed at T0 and then after 6 weeks of conventional therapy (occupational therapy, physical therapy, aquatic therapy, musicotherapy, others)

Other: Ready2E.A.T. PROGRAM
Training tasks based on: reaching activities during attention tasks, memory tasks, sequential tasks This group was assessed at T0 and then after 6 weeks of conventional therapy.

Ready2E.A.T. therapy

Group doing Ready2E.A.T. program received a mean of 1 hour per week and was assessed at T0 and then after 6 weeks of this program implementation.

Outcome Measures

Primary Outcome Measures

  1. Video analysis of feeding performance [6 weeks]

    performance of several feeding steps

Secondary Outcome Measures

  1. Frontal assessment battery [6 weeks]

    Assessment of Executive Functions

Eligibility Criteria

Criteria

Ages Eligible for Study:
N/A and Older
Sexes Eligible for Study:
All
Inclusion Criteria:
  • people with 60years old with cognitive decline

  • children aging 6-10 years old with cognitive and motor dysfunction

  • dysfunction in feeding participation

Exclusion Criteria:
  • participants that do not understand 2 simnultaneous verbal commands
